Having trouble adjusting the float Valve?
First, determine where the operating water level should be. The manufacturer's maintenance manual is a good place to start. Something like 5" below the overflow level is common.
For a standard mechanical float:
· Turn off the make-up and drain or add water to achieve the recommended operating level in the basin.
· Adjust the float arm so the make up valve is closed with the float exerting moderate closing pressure on the valve.
· Turn on the make-up water and confirm the float valve is closed. Adjust the float ball slightly if necessary.
· Drain a small amount of water from the basin and observe that the float valve will maintain the desired level.
· Once the level is set, hold the float down and fill the basin to its overflow level.
· Close the access door; You're done.
